This session will explore the evolving landscape of US onshore and offshore wind financing, examining how shifting regulatory and policy frameworks are impacting both opportunities and risks for investors, lenders, and developers. Expert speakers will consider:

  • How can developers, investors, and lenders collaborate to overcome some of the challenges that the US wind market faces today? 
  • Which US transactions in onshore or offshore wind should the market seek to emulate? 
  • How can lessons from European wind projects be applied in the US?

As project finance enters its next phase, the forces reshaping the market are increasingly clear: rising power demand, the acceleration of sustainable infrastructure, and the rapid expansion of data centres. This workshop will bring together women across the industry to examine how these themes are redefining investment priorities, risk allocation, financing structures, and long-term project delivery.
